Thc degrades into cbn over time and during overripening. I would say pick them asap before it degrades anymore as cbn is not nearly as effective as thc. On a side note if they aren't too far overripe your looking at one foggy high :)
 
i say you can never go by the crappy ass times that a breeder gives you to begin with... at best, they are a very rough estimate of when a plant CAN finish if it was given all of the proper everything... if somethings in the grow weren't up to snuff, so more rainy days than sunny, hotter than normal temps, high humidty etc.. any and all of these things can and do affect when your plants will finish for sure..
being two weeks over really isn't that bad ime... i'd wait a day or so till it wasn't raining so that they have a lil chance to dry out first before you cut them as it will surely cut down on any chances that you get any bud mold/ rot, and it will also speed up their drying times for sure..
